Our customers rely on Palantir's platforms for some of their most critical operations, and projects often start with an open ended question like "Why are we delaying so many flights?" or "How can we better identify instances of money laundering?" As an FDSE, you'll apply your problem solving ability, creativity, and technical skills to help organizations use their data to drive a real impact in the world. You'll have the opportunity to gain rare insight into and contribute to some of the world's most important industries and institutions. As an FDSE on the Tactical Edge, your responsibilities look similar to those of a startup CTO: you'll work in small teams with minimal supervision and own end-to-end execution of high stakes projects. You'll apply your problem solving ability, creativity, and technical skills to deploy and manage Palantir software across a variety of hardware form factors, ranging in size, location, and accessibility.
